12 lines
367 B
Dart
12 lines
367 B
Dart
import 'package:pshared/data/dto/storable.dart';
|
|
import 'package:pshared/models/storable.dart';
|
|
|
|
|
|
extension StorableMapper on Storable {
|
|
StorableDTO toDTO() => StorableDTO(id: id, createdAt: createdAt, updatedAt: updatedAt);
|
|
}
|
|
|
|
extension StorableDTOMapper on StorableDTO {
|
|
Storable toDomain() => newStorable(id: id, createdAt: createdAt, updatedAt: updatedAt);
|
|
}
|